Set-X400AuthoritativeDomain

 

适用于: Exchange Server 2007 SP3, Exchange Server 2007 SP2, Exchange Server 2007 SP1

上一次修改主题: 2007-06-28

使用 Set-X400AuthoritativeDomain cmdlet 可以编辑 Microsoft Exchange Server 2007 组织的现有 X.400 权威域。X.400 权威域为所有分配了 X.400 地址的邮箱定义附加到收件人标识中的命名空间的标准字段。

语法

Set-X400AuthoritativeDomain -Identity <X400AuthoritativeDomainIdParameter> [-Confirm [<SwitchParameter>]] [-DomainController <Fqdn>] [-Name <String>] [-WhatIf [<SwitchParameter>]] [-X400DomainName <X400Domain>] [-X400ExternalRelay <$true | $false>]

Set-X400AuthoritativeDomain [-Confirm [<SwitchParameter>]] [-DomainController <Fqdn>] [-Instance <X400AuthoritativeDomain>] [-Name <String>] [-WhatIf [<SwitchParameter>]] [-X400DomainName <X400Domain>] [-X400ExternalRelay <$true | $false>]

详细说明

X.400 域名只能包含下列 ASCII 字符:

  • A 到 Z

  • a 到 z

  • 0-9

  • 以下标点符号和特殊字符:(空格) ' () + , - . / : = ?

可以使用下列 X.400 属性:

  • **名称:**国家/地区

    • **缩写:**C

    • 最大字符长度: 2

    • 每个地址的最大实例数: 1

  • **名称:**管理域

    • **缩写:**A

    • 最大字符长度: 16

    • 每个地址的最大实例数: 1

  • **名称:**专用域

    • **缩写:**P

    • 最大字符长度: 16

    • 每个地址的最大实例数: 1

  • **名称:**组织名

    • **缩写:**O

    • 最大字符长度: 64

    • 每个地址的最大实例数: 1

  • **名称:**组织单位名

    • **缩写:**Ou1-4

    • 最大字符长度: 32

    • **每个地址的最大实例数:**每个地址 1 个实例

若要运行 Set-X400AuthoritativeDomain cmdlet,必须为您使用的帐户委派以下角色:

  • Exchange Server 管理员角色和目标服务器的本地 Administrators 组

有关权限、角色委派以及管理 Exchange 2007 所需权限的详细信息,请参阅权限注意事项

参数

参数 必需 类型 说明

Identity

必需

Microsoft.Exchange.Configuration.Tasks.X400AuthoritativeDomainIdParameter

使用此参数可以指定 X.400 权威域的显示名称。

Confirm

可选

System.Management.Automation.SwitchParameter

Confirm 参数将导致命令暂停处理,并且需要您在处理继续之前确认该命令将执行的操作。不必为 Confirm 参数指定值。

DomainController

可选

Microsoft.Exchange.Data.Fqdn

若要指定从 Active Directory 目录服务写入此配置信息的域控制器的完全限定的域名 (FQDN),请在命令中包含 DomainController 参数。已安装边缘传输服务器角色的计算机不支持 DomainController 参数。边缘传输服务器角色只会写入和读取本地 Active Directory 应用程序模式 (ADAM) 目录服务。

Instance

可选

Microsoft.Exchange.Data.Directory.SystemConfiguration.X400AuthoritativeDomain

使用此参数可以将整个对象传递给此命令进行处理。此参数主要用于必须将整个对象传递给命令的脚本。

Name

可选

System.String

使用此参数可以为 X.400 权威域对象创建唯一名称。如果指定的名称包含空格,则必须将整个名称放在引号中,例如 "Display Name"。Name 参数只能包含 64 个或更少的字符。

WhatIf

可选

System.Management.Automation.SwitchParameter

WhatIf 参数指示命令模拟对对象执行的操作。通过使用 WhatIf 参数,您可以查看要发生的更改,而不必应用任何这些更改。不必为 WhatIf 参数指定值。

X400DomainName

可选

Microsoft.Exchange.Data.X400Domain

X400DomainName 参数中指定的 X.400 命名空间只能包含 X.400 组织组件。尤其是,只支持下列属性类型:

  • 标签(缩写)

  • C(国家/地区)

  • A (ADMD)

  • P (PRMD)

  • O(组织)

  • OU1(组织单位 1)

  • OU2(组织单位 2)

  • OU3(组织单位 3)

  • OU4(组织单位 4)

必须使用分号分隔地址属性,并且必须为地址加上引号,例如:

"C=US;A=att;P=Contoso;O=Example"

X400ExternalRelay

可选

System.Boolean

使用此参数可以将此权威域指定为外部中继域。如果将 X400ExternalRelay 设置为 $true,Microsoft Exchange 则将电子邮件路由到外部地址,并且不会将此子域的解析失败视为错误。

输入类型

返回类型

错误

错误 说明

 

示例

以下代码示例对现有 X.400 权威域进行下列更改:

  • 将域名从“Sales”更改为“Sales and Marketing”。

  • 将组织属性更新为“Sales and Marketing”。

Set-X400AuthoritativeDomain Sales -X400DomainName "C=US;A=att,P=Contoso;O=Sales and Marketing"  -Name "Sales and Marketing"